What are the benefits of banana ?

The banana is the fruit of fitness. With 90Kcal per 100g and 20% carbohydrates, it's one of the fruits that provides our body with the most rapid energy. It is very rich in nutrients. It contains most of the B group vitamins (notably B1, B2, B3 and B5, which combat physical and mental fatigue) and vitamin C, a source of energy. 100g of banana covers 10% of our RDA (recommended daily allowance) in vitamin C. Finally, bananas contain 13 minerals, the main ones being magnesium, iron and phosphorus, which are sources of energy.

Bananas are systematically recommended as part of a balanced diet, particularly for active people and athletes, thanks to their many nutritional benefits.

The benefits of bananas for athletes :

  • Fast source of energy : Bananas are rich in carbohydrates, particularly natural sugars (glucose, fructose and sucrose), making them an excellent source of quick energy. Ideal for athletes before, during or after physical exertion.

  • Rich in potassium : Potassium plays a crucial role in preventing muscle cramps, regulating water balance and maintaining healthy nerve and muscle function. An average banana contains around 422 mg of potassium.

  • Promotes recovery : The carbohydrates in bananas help replenish muscle glycogen stores after exercise, essential for muscle recovery.

  • Source of vitamins : Bananas provide essential vitamins such as vitamin C, vitamin B6 and vitamin A. Vitamin B6, in particular, is important for protein metabolism and energy production.

  • Digestion and intestinal health : Rich in fiber, bananas help regulate intestinal transit, which is beneficial for athletes in terms of digestive comfort and nutrient absorption.

  • Cardiovascular health : Potassium helps regulate blood pressure and, combined with a low sodium intake, bananas can contribute to cardiovascular health.

  • Antioxidant effect : Bananas contain antioxidants such as dopamine and catechins, which can reduce oxidative damage and improve recovery after exercise.

  • Weight management : Although energetic, bananas have a high satiety index. It can be a convenient and satisfying snack for athletes watching their calorie intake.

  • Psychological support : Vitamin B6 helps produce serotonin, which can improve mood and reduce stress, beneficial before a competition or intense training session.

  • Hydration : Although water is the main source of hydration, minerals such as potassium in bananas play a role in maintaining water balance.
These benefits make bananas a popular choice among athletes of all levels for their nutritional intake, convenience and benefits for performance and recovery.
